My name's and Im 21yrs old.

I was diagnosed with A. in March '09 after just a year of suffering ( It only

took one year for me to go from healthy to unable to tolerate even fluids).

I was given botox treatment with no success, and eventually fitted with NG

feeding tubes until i had my Hellers Myotomy in June '09.

The hellers didn't work as well as hoped and further investigations are needed

to find out why.

I am now 23weeks pregnant, and my OH also suffers from A. He had his hellers

back in 2002 with complete success and only occasionally has any problems.

Although my consultants are positive that the baby WILL NOT inherit A. from us,

i can't help but be concerned. I'm terrified that he will and that he will have

to suffer as so many of us do.

People keep telling me that im worrying over nothing but i can't help it!

Am i stupid to worry?
